Output 11e527133159efae85fbc6efc3a81fea45c0376e6114b317b30c6306f03d16cb:1

value
31383
script pubkey
OP_0 OP_PUSHBYTES_20 d3f5c9fc125ee16840b070de7aa35e2aa133edad
address
bc1q606unlqjtmskss9swr084g6792sn8mdd9p5889
transaction
11e527133159efae85fbc6efc3a81fea45c0376e6114b317b30c6306f03d16cb
confirmations
342697
spent
true